Class of 2020 Guard Dayten Holman Makes Unofficial Visit to OSU
Class of 2020 in-state standout Dayten Holman is making an unofficial visit to Oklahoma State’s campus on Thursday, a source told Pistols Firing.
Holman is a combo guard from Norman, Okla., who has garnered offers from OSU, OU, Ole Miss, Houston, Tulane and Tulsa this spring. He’s been one of the fastest-rising prospects on the AAU circuit, and is considered to be one of the top targets for the Cowboys in the 2020 class.

Holman is an impressive 6-6 guard who can play either point or off the ball, and does a little of everything really well. He has excellent court vision, has the athleticism to create shots both for himself and for others, and has the length and strength to develop into a lockdown defender on the perimeter.
Holman is yet another big-name visitor for OSU this week in three days. Yesterday, five-star 2020 big man Isaiah Todd visited unofficially, and the day before, Davion Bradford, Kalib Boone and Keylan Boone also made the trip to Stillwater.
Holman is one of a handful of in-state targets for OSU in the 2020 class, as OSU is also targeting Booker T. Washington’s Bryce Thompson, Putnam City West’s Rondel Walker, as well as potentially the aforementioned Bradford, who recently moved to the state.
